kHz激光与固体靶相互作用产生的X射线源

摘    要:利用kHz激光与固体靶相互作用产生了平均流强为1.3×107 photons·sr-1·s-1的X射线源, 研究了激光的对比度和能量对激光与固体靶相互作用产生的X射线能谱及Kα 产额的影响, 使用刀边成像技术测量了X射线源的源尺寸, 并进行了初步的成像实验. 实验中观察到对于非相对论级别的激光脉冲, 降低激光的对比度有利于提高Kα 产额, 而使用高对比度高强度激光, 更有利于获得高通量高信噪比X射线源. 关键词: kHz激光 固体靶 X射线

X-ray source produced by laser solid target interaction at kHz repetition rate

Abstract:X-ray radiation with an average flux of 1.3×107 photons·sr-1·s-1 is generated by the interaction between ultra-short laser and solid target working at 1 kHz repetition rate. A knife edge is introduced to measure the source size. The X-ray emission shows obvious dependences on the laser contrast and intensity. It is discovered that at lower intensity the Kα yield increases with lower laser contrast. However, by using high contrast and high intensity laser pulses, high flux and high signal-to-noise ratio Kα X-ray can be generated. The generated source is used in proof-of-principle radiograghic imaging of simple specimens.
